IFRS 9: A Knowledge Exchange Workshop on Implementation and Challenges
Research-led IFRS 9 workshop exploring ECL, judgement and comparability, with keynote speakers and academic discussions.
Financial Reporting under IFRS 9
Join us for a research-led, in-person knowledge exchange workshop focused on the challenges and implications of IFRS 9.
This event brings together academic researchers, external experts, and early career scholars to explore key issues in financial reporting, including Expected Credit Loss (ECL), managerial judgement, comparability, and market reactions.
Keynote Speakers:
• Professor Argyro Panaretou (Lancaster University)
• Professor Enrico Onali (University of Bristol)
The programme includes keynote presentations, selected research paper presentations, discussant-led feedback, and a panel discussion.
Panel Discussion:
The workshop will feature a dedicated panel session on “IFRS 9 in Practice: Importance, Challenges, and Benefits,” bringing together keynote speakers and invited experts. The panel will explore why IFRS 9 matters, its practical implications, and key challenges in implementation.
